Studwork installation services involve the placement and fitting of interior and exterior wall panels, ceiling boards, and other structural or decorative elements made from materials like drywall, plasterboard, or wood panels. These services are essential for creating smooth, finished surfaces in rooms, whether for new construction, renovations, or repair projects. Skilled contractors prepare the space, measure accurately, and carefully install panels to ensure a clean, professional appearance. Proper installation helps improve the overall look of a property and provides a solid foundation for painting, wallpapering, or other finishing touches.

This service helps address common problems such as uneven or damaged walls, gaps, or cracks that can compromise the aesthetics and functionality of a space. When walls are cracked, bowed, or have holes, installing new studwork or panels can restore structural integrity and improve insulation. Additionally, if a property has outdated or unsightly surfaces, studwork installation can provide a fresh, clean backdrop for decorating or remodeling efforts. It can also be a solution for creating new interior partitions or upgrading existing walls to better suit modern needs.

Properties that typically utilize studwork installation range from residential homes to small commercial buildings. Homeowners often seek these services during major renovations, room extensions, or when upgrading interior finishes. Older properties with deteriorating walls or uneven surfaces are common candidates, as well as new builds that require interior framing and partitioning. Smaller commercial spaces, such as offices or retail shops, may also need studwork installation to create functional layouts or improve the appearance of their interiors. Overall, any property requiring wall repairs, upgrades, or new interior structures can benefit from professional studwork installation.

The overview below groups typical Studwork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Redmond,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or studwork repairs or small installations range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.

Partial Wall Installations - Installing or modifying sections of studwork for interior walls us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Larger or more complex projects can reach $2,500 or more, but most projects stay within the mid-range.

Full Wall Replacements - Replacing entire interior or exterior wall framing often costs from $1,500 to $4,000. Larger, more detailed projects, especially those involving custom framing, can exceed $5,000.

Custom or Complex Projects - Highly detailed or structural studwork projects, such as load-bearing walls or specialty framing, tend to range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. These are less common and typically represent the higher end of the cost spectrum for local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
